The Nigeria Football Federation has ratified the change of name of the Nigeria Professional Football League to the Nigeria Premier Football League before the start of the 2023/23 season.
This was done at the 79th general assembly of the country’s football governing body on Sunday in Uyo.
“The congress approved the change of name of the Nigeria Professional Football League to the Nigeria Premier Football League,” NFF said in a communique.
The new board of the NPFL had paraded the league as the Nigeria Premier Football League, launching a new logo and new name for the league but the NFF had also insisted that only the congress has the power to change the name.
The 2023/24 NPFL season was scheduled to kick-off on Saturday, September 9 with a curtain raiser between 3SC and Plateau United in Ibadan but the league suffered another postponement due to what the board called exigencies around its sponsorship.
A new date for the kick-off is expected to be announced in due course.
Enyimba won the league last season during the Super 6 playoffs in Lagos to be crowned champions for a record nine times.
